嘿,大家好!今天我要和大家分享一个超实用的技能——轻松搭建个人静态网站。你可能觉得这听起来有点复杂,但其实,从零开始,跟着我的教程,你也能轻松搞定!
首先,你得有一个想法。比如说,你想建立一个个人博客,或者一个展示自己作品的网站。确定了方向之后,我们就可以开始动手了。
第一步,选择一个合适的网站搭建平台。市面上有很多这样的平台,比如GitHub Pages、Vercel、Netlify等等。我个人比较推荐GitHub Pages,因为它免费、简单,而且支持Markdown语法,非常适合写博客。
接下来,你需要注册一个GitHub账号。如果你已经是一个GitHub用户,那就直接登录。没有的话,就去官网注册一个吧。注册完账号后,你就可以创建一个新的仓库(repository)了。
创建仓库的时候,记得勾选“Initialize this repository with a README”和“Add a .gitignore file for ignoring ignored files”。这样,你的仓库就会自动生成一个README文件和一个.gitignore文件,方便后续操作。
现在,我们开始上传你的网站内容。首先,你需要安装一个代码编辑器,比如Visual Studio Code、Sublime Text或者Atom。然后,将你的网站文件上传到GitHub仓库中。上传完成后,点击仓库页面上的“Actions”按钮,等待几秒钟,你的网站就会自动部署到GitHub Pages上。
如果你上传的是Markdown文件,那么在浏览器中直接访问你的GitHub Pages地址,就能看到你的网站了。如果你上传的是HTML、CSS、JavaScript等文件,那么你需要编写一个简单的服务器端脚本,比如使用Node.js的Express框架,来处理这些文件。
其实,说到这里,你可能会有点懵。别担心,接下来我会详细讲解如何编写服务器端脚本,让你的静态网站支持动态内容。
首先,你需要安装Node.js和npm(Node.js的包管理器)。安装完成后,在你的网站根目录下创建一个名为“server.js”的文件,并编写以下代码:
```javascriptconst express = require('express');const path = require('path');const app = express();app.use(express.static(path.join(__dirname, 'public')));app.listen(3000, () => { console.log('Server is running on port 3000');});```这段代码的作用是创建一个简单的服务器,并指定静态文件所在的目录。保存文件后,在终端中运行“node server.js”命令,你的服务器就会启动了。
现在,你可以在浏览器中访问“http://localhost:3000/”,看到你的网站了。如果你想让网站支持HTTPS,那么你需要购买一个SSL证书,并配置你的服务器。
总结一下,搭建个人静态网站其实并不复杂。只需要选择一个合适的平台,上传你的网站内容,然后编写一个简单的服务器端脚本,你的网站就能正常运行了。希望我的教程能帮助你轻松搭建自己的静态网站!
转载请注明来自艺唯思号,本文标题:《轻松搭建个人静态网站 从零开始 教程全解析》













京公网安备11000000000001号
京ICP备11000001号
还没有评论,来说两句吧...